The Ballon d’Or rankings for August 2026 have been released by Score 90, with Real Madrid forward Kylian Mbappé currently leading the race for the prestigious individual award.
Mbappé’s position at the top of the ranking is largely down to his outstanding performances for France at the 2026 FIFA World Cup in North America. The Real Madrid star scored 10 goals and provided four assists during the tournament, helping France finish in fourth place.
The French forward also achieved a remarkable individual feat during the year. Mbappé became the first player to win the Golden Boot awards in LaLiga, the UEFA Champions League and the FIFA World Cup in the same calendar year, further strengthening his case for the Ballon d’Or.
Barcelona youngster Lamine Yamal occupies second place in the August ranking. The Spanish winger played a key role in Barcelona’s success, helping the Catalan giants secure both the LaLiga title and the Supercopa de España. He also made an important contribution to Spain’s campaign at the World Cup.
Yamal’s continued rise has placed him among the leading contenders for the award despite his young age. His performances at club and international level have made him one of the most influential young players in world football.
Bayern Munich striker Harry Kane is ranked third. The England captain enjoyed an exceptional campaign with the German club, scoring 73 goals and helping Bayern Munich win a domestic double while also reaching the semi-finals of the Champions League.
Kane was also influential for England at the 2026 World Cup, helping the Three Lions finish in third place. His extraordinary goalscoring record for Bayern, combined with his contribution to England’s run in North America, has kept him firmly in contention for the Ballon d’Or.
Former Manchester City midfielder Rodri is fourth in the Score 90 ranking. The Spain international, who won the 2024 Ballon d’Or, played a crucial role in Spain’s World Cup triumph and was named the tournament’s Most Valuable Player after receiving the Golden Ball.
Rodri also enjoyed success at club level during the year. The midfielder, who now plays for Barcelona, won the Carabao Cup and the FA Cup with Manchester City, adding further silverware to his impressive résumé.
Manchester City striker Erling Haaland completes the top five. The Norwegian forward scored seven goals during his debut FIFA World Cup campaign with Norway and also helped Manchester City win both the Carabao Cup and the FA Cup.
Haaland finished the 2025-26 season with an impressive 38 goals in 52 appearances across all competitions. His remarkable scoring numbers, combined with his domestic success and World Cup contribution, have kept him among the leading candidates for the 2026 Ballon d’Or.
The current top five ranking therefore features Mbappé in first, followed by Yamal, Kane, Rodri and Haaland. With the Ballon d’Or race still developing, performances during the coming months could significantly alter the standings before the final award is decided.
